“…The basins of the cooler western domain are characterized by well-developed coarse clastic formations related to paleoscarps on the border of the troughs, in relation to high-angle faulting and dominant brittle behavior of the continental crust (e.g., the Igountze and Mendibelza breccias; Boirie 1981; Boirie and Souquet 1982;Masini et al, 2014). In contrast, the central part of these basins is a domain of exhumed mantle capped by tectonic lenses of both ultramafic and sialic compositions tectonically underlying the prerift metasediments.…”

“…The occurrence of distinct Albian coarse-grained turbidite systems along the northern margin of the BCB indicates that this basin margin had to be a very narrow margin during the Albian, with relatively short distances between the emerged source areas and the deep-water basins. Moreover, the Andatza turbidite system is similar in terms of processes and products to the contemporaneous Mendibeltza turbidite system of the Pyrenean realm (Souquet et al, 1985), where a narrow southern basin-margin area that fed the Pyrenean basin has been interpreted (Razin, 1989;Masini et al, 2014).…”
